Controller – Consulting | Full-Time | Oklahoma City, OK
$110k – $140k + Benefits | Permanent Opportunity

NOW CFO is a premier consulting firm that has been delivering tailored accounting solutions to businesses nationwide since 2005. Our consultants work hands-on with clients, providing the financial expertise and strategic insight needed to help businesses thrive. We are collaborative, growth-minded, and passionate about making a measurable impact.

We are seeking a Controller to join our consulting team as a full-time, permanent hire in Oklahoma City. This is an exciting opportunity for a driven accounting leader who thrives on problem-solving, guiding businesses, and building strong financial foundations.

As a Controller at NOW CFO, you’ll bring more than just technical skills, you’ll act as a trusted advisor, helping clients mitigate risk, improve profitability, and make informed business decisions.

What You’ll Do

  • Lead and oversee day-to-day accounting operations, including A/R, A/P, GL, and payroll.

  • Manage key accounting functions such as job costing, WIP, inventory, and revenue recognition.

  • Establish and maintain internal controls, budgets, and performance metrics.

  • Deliver accurate and timely financial reporting.

  • Own the month-end and year-end close processes.

  • Standardize systems and processes to drive efficiency.

  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local regulations.

  • Partner with leadership to guide financial decision-making.

  • Mentor and develop accounting staff.

  • Champion positive change and continuous improvement.

What We’re Looking For

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ance.

  • Strong knowledge of GAAP and full-cycle accounting.

  • Background in consulting or audit (preferred).

  • Experience leading or managing accounting teams (preferred).

  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and accounting software.
